Lcm (4,10) = 20 lcm calculator first number and second number and calculate lcm least common multiple of 4 and 10 with gcf formula the formula of lcm is lcm (a,b) = ( a × b) / gcf (a,b). 4 4 has factors of 2 2 and 2 2. Lcm (10, 4) = 20 what is the least common multiple? In simple terms, the lcm is the smallest possible whole number (an integer) that divides evenly into all of the numbers in the set.
